About İbrahim Burak Özyurt
İbrahim Burak Özyurt is a scholar working on Information Systems and Management, Artificial Intelligence and Statistics, Probability and Uncertainty, having authored 40 papers that have together received 986 indexed citations. Recurring topics across this work include Biomedical Text Mining and Ontologies (13 papers), Topic Modeling (8 papers) and Scientific Computing and Data Management (7 papers). The work is most often cited by research in Information Systems and Management (110 citations), Artificial Intelligence (337 citations) and Health Informatics (14 citations). İbrahim Burak Özyurt has collaborated with scholars based in United States, Türkiye and Australia. Frequent co-authors include Lawrence Hall, James C. Bezdek, Jeffrey S. Grethe, Christine Fennema‐Notestine, Anita Bandrowski, Gregory G. Brown, Camellia P. Clark, Mark W. Bondi, Amanda Bischoff‐Grethe and Shaunna Morris. Their work appears in journals such as PLoS ONE, NeuroImage and Diabetes.
